Facts About Athletics Training In Greece

Athletics training in Greece reflects discipline shaped by structured programs, historical influence, and modern sports development. The focus on physical conditioning and technical training defines how athletes prepare and compete across different levels.


Training Structure And Organization

  • Athletics training in Greece is organized through clubs, schools, and national programs.

  • Sports clubs in Greece provide structured environments for athlete development.

  • Training schedules in Greece are typically consistent and seasonally planned.

  • Professional coaching in Greece supports technical and physical improvement.

  • National federations in Greece oversee athletic training standards.

 

Types Of Athletic Training

  • Athletics training in Greece includes track and field, endurance, and strength disciplines.

  • Sprint training in Greece focuses on speed and acceleration techniques.

  • Distance training in Greece emphasizes endurance and pacing strategies.

  • Field event training in Greece develops skills such as jumping and throwing.

  • Strength and conditioning in Greece supports overall athletic performance.
